Tigerbrands- Worms Infested Oats

My name is Thuso Mokoena. On the 8th May 2025 I sent a customer complaint notification to Tigerbrands regarding jungle oats manufactured 28.11.2024 with best before date of 28.11.2025 for worms infestation and mould. I received a reference number of TB*** on 13 May 2025 with response saying they will engage me via sms and they routed the complaint to the relevant department. On the email, there was no apology for any inconvenience caused, they didn’t even bother to check if the infestation that occurred as a result of their non conforming oats affected the other groceries in my pantry, there was absolutely no sense of remorse or empathy. Tigerbrands didn’t demonstrate any kind of accountability or concern about how this could have affected me or my family, what the repercussions of consuming the oats would have been. Instead, Tigerbrands did exactly what the Store where I bought the oats would have done. They sent me R80 voucher yesterday via sms clearly to replace the oats I complaint about. I’m asking myself what was the point of taking the complaint to the manufacturer of the product instead of the Store where I bought the product because the remedy provided by the manufacturer isn’t in any way different from what the store would have done? This made me feel like Tigerbrands doesn’t show care to its product consumers or value their reputation less irrespective of being in the news pertaining to Listeriosis cases. Where is the feedback on the root cause that led to this non conforming oats, remedial action to ensure there was no further distribution or products on shelves being recalled to protect the nation as a whole furthermore a corrective action to ensure this type of a non conformance doesn’t recur? Deeply disappointed by how you deal with customer complaints
